Senior Application Analyst and Developer (RPG) - Remote Position
Location: Tulsa, OK or Remote
Description
The successful candidate will perform solution development and delivery. This position will work in developing applications using RPG with DB2.
Essential duties and responsibilities include the following:
Communicate, maintain, develop and enforce coding standards.
Design and code superior technical solutions while recognizing system deficiencies, suggesting and implementing effective solutions.
Provide code reviews.
Demonstrate expert knowledge in RPG.
Provide high quality service to clients/customers/co-workers while maintaining a professional standard.
Translate design requirements and specifications into robust high-quality code implementations.
Perform code unit tests and demonstrate the ability to properly validate the functionality of work produced.
Provide innovative insight into the design of code in a component or sub-component of the system.
Work closely with other departments within IT to ensure high-quality code and practices.
Ensure all communication coming from Software Development is complete and professional.
Work independently with limited supervision as well as within a team environment.
Maintain an established level of productivity using time management techniques.
Able to shift between priorities as needed throughout the workday.
Participate in an on-call rotation to provide system support outside of normal working hours.
Perform other duties as assigned.
Job Requirements
Candidate must have a bachelor’s degree in Information Technology or a related field. Equivalent work experience will be considered.
Prior development of financial and/or insurance related systems is preferred.
Candidate must have the following (some are must and others are plus):
5+ years of combined experience designing, developing, and supporting applications using RPG in an IBM iSeries systems environment.
Advanced level knowledge of RPG and CL.
Experience with Aldon Life Cycle Manager or similar change management software.
Working knowledge of structured query language and embedded SQL in RPG.
Ability to manage multiple projects and meet deadlines while adjusting to and implementing numerous policy and procedural changes.
Experience working with other programming languages or development environments.
Ability to write clear, concise, and logical technical documentation.
Experience using ServiceNow is a plus.
Experience working with IBM Rational Developer for i is a plus.
Experience using IBM System i Navigator is a plus.
Experience with Profound Logic is a plus.
